The two respondents picked plays with zero- and two-inner board blots. As Robertie said (and I find the principal unconvincing), seek middling plays. The one-blot play is correct, though by a small margin. Can anyone provide a convincing explanation?
1. | Rollout1 | 6/5 6/4* | eq: +0.189 |
| Player: Opponent: | 61.74% (G:18.44% B:0.31%) 38.26% (G:11.53% B:0.75%) | Conf.: ± 0.008 (+0.181...+0.196) - [100.0%] Duration: 21 minutes 09 seconds |
|
2. | Rollout1 | 12/10 5/4* | eq: +0.164 (-0.025) |
| Player: Opponent: | 60.44% (G:20.54% B:0.20%) 39.56% (G:11.59% B:0.54%) | Conf.: ± 0.008 (+0.156...+0.171) - [0.0%] Duration: 24 minutes 16 seconds |
|
3. | Rollout1 | 13/10 | eq: +0.153 (-0.035) |
| Player: Opponent: | 59.95% (G:14.42% B:0.18%) 40.05% (G:5.62% B:0.31%) | Conf.: ± 0.006 (+0.147...+0.160) - [0.0%] Duration: 20 minutes 10 seconds |
|
4. | Rollout1 | 13/12 6/4* | eq: +0.153 (-0.036) |
| Player: Opponent: | 60.17% (G:20.50% B:0.23%) 39.83% (G:12.67% B:0.55%) | Conf.: ± 0.008 (+0.145...+0.161) - [0.0%] Duration: 21 minutes 08 seconds |
|
5. | Rollout1 | 13/11 5/4* | eq: +0.133 (-0.056) |
| Player: Opponent: | 59.86% (G:21.72% B:0.23%) 40.14% (G:16.10% B:0.92%) | Conf.: ± 0.008 (+0.125...+0.141) - [0.0%] Duration: 22 minutes 40 seconds |
